Mockbuster review – how to survive the nightmare of directing a terrible low-budget horror film

Struggling to make it in Australia, aspiring director Anthony Frith cold-calls the team behind Sharknado and bites off more than he can chew in this making-of documentary‘A bad movie is better than no movie” is the motto of this behind-the-scenes documentary, which charts director Anthony Frith’s quest to make his debut feature for ultra-schlock studio The Asylum; it doubles up as an affable salute to film-making savoir-faire.Stuck making corporate videos to support his young family, Adelaide-based Frith is in danger…
